Staff

Fr. Mark J. George, S.J., is pastor of Sts. Peter and Paul Jesuit Church.  He has been a Jesuit for 20 years, and a priest for 10.  Previously, he was an associate at Gesu-Toledo, at Our Lady of LaSalette-Berkley MI, and most recently at Gesu-Cleveland until October 2008.

Fr. George is an artist, specializing in oil painting.  He is interested in social justice issues, whether global or local, and this was something that first attracted him to the Society of Jesus.  He is a bi-ritual priest and does some masses in the Maronite (Lebanese) Rite.  Fr. George is also a very knowledgeable baseball fan, or perhaps a sports fan in general.  "It is nice to have two stadiums almost in my backyard.," Fr. George says. "Letʼs hope that those two teams start imitating the success of the two winter sports!"

Fr. George is assisted by the parish office manager, Lydia Maola and the Director of the Warming Center, Fr. Ben Jimenez, S.J.
